Three Boys From Same Parents Die In Fire Incident In Bayelsa

The three sons of Mr and Mrs Udoh were killed in a fire incident at their home in Bayelsa on January 14th. Narrating the sad incident to ...
The three sons of Mr and Mrs Udoh were killed in a fire incident at their home in Bayelsa on January 14th. Narrating the sad incident to Daily Sun, Udoh, who is a commercial motorcyclist, said on the day of the incident, he had returned from work and had asked his daughter to buy him some drugs. He said his wife who sells food had gone to the market to buy materials she needed to make Suallu bean cake and pap, which she sells to residents in the neighbourhood.

He said after waiting for his daughter who did not return on time, he decided to go and look for her and left his three sons who were asleep at home. Unfortunately, he locked them inside the house, hoping to come back on time.

Not long after he left the house, neighbors started shouting "Fire, Fire" and running to his house. Before they could break open the door, the boys had burnt to death. Preliminary investigation by the police concluded that the fire incident was caused by a lit candle, but residents of the area held the contrary view that the fire was a mystery.

One of the neighbors of the family, who gave her name simply as Josephine, said nobody could explain how the fire started because it burnt the two rooms of the landlord before consuming the house of the Udohs. According to her, the fire was so intense that before people could rescue the children, they had been burnt to death. However, she noted that the children might have been able to escape if the door was not locked from outside.

The mother of the boys has remained inconsolable since the incident happened. When she was visited at her new apartment, she couldn't speak at all. A relative of the Udoh's, Victoria Dominic also narrated the sad incident. She also believes that the fire incident was mysterious.

“On Thursday around 8 pm, her husband was in the house, she sells bean cake and akamu. She went out to buy some ingredients and collect her phone from where she used to charge it because she does not want to use lantern or candle because of the kerosene in the house. From there the husband went to check their first daughter who was sent to buy drugs. It was from there they heard shouts of fire and when they got to the house and open the door, the three boys inside had been roasted to death. There was no way to rescue them. They are in a terrible state and they are in need of help. They have nothing left. The husband’s motorcycle is gone, and all their life savings are gone too. The Apostolic church where we are worshiping has been helping but people need to come to their assistance and provide the capital they need to start their business again. People are donating clothes to them. We appeal to the state government and well meaning Bayelsans to come to their aid,” she said.

The corpses of the dead sons were initially deposited at the mortuary of the Federal Medical Centre for autopsy and further investigations but the bodies were later released to the family for burial.

Chibok Girls: Army Makes Significant Arrest

Jarasu Shirawho, who is believed to be the sect leader around Damboa-Chibok-Askira axis of Borno state before he was apprehended last week i...

Jarasu Shirawho, who is believed to be the sect leader around Damboa-Chibok-Askira axis of Borno state before he was apprehended last week in the state is believed to be one of the masterminds of the Chibok girls abduction.

Disclosing details of the arrest of the suspected leader of the Boko Haram sect, Major General Lucky Irabor, the deputy theatre commander of Operation Lafiya Dole, told the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) in Maiduguri that the suspect was arrested in one of the routine operations by soldiers.

He said: “We have in our custody a good number of suspected terrorists that were apprehended as a result of our routine operations.

“One of those suspects is believed to be on the list of our 100 most wanted terrorists’ leaders.”

General Irabor however noted that there was need to ascertain the true identity of the suspect before final confirmation to the media.

He said this was to avoid past mistakes where individuals were arrested based on mistaken identities.

“There are checks that must be done before final confirmation, facial attributes tended to show that he is the one.


“But then, there are other things we need to do to ensure that is he who we said he is. Although the facial attributes confirmed he is the one, but it is not just by looks alone.

“We have had cases where we had mistaken identity only to come up to say we are sorry, that is what we are trying to avoid this time,” he said.

Meanwhile, an attack by three suicide bombers in Maiduguri on Friday, January 22 was foiled by the military just a kilometre into the troubled town.

Brigadier General Lucky Irabor who disclosed details of the botched attack said the suicide bombers were intercepted while trying to get passage into Maiduguri by vigilant men a kilometre ahead of the town, along Mafa road.

Ritualist Beheads 4 Year Old Boy In Osun State (Photo)

Tribune reports that Ganiyu in connivance with other member of his ritualistic gang namely Aremu Moshood (48), Agboola Abdulwasiu (31) an...
Tribune reports that Ganiyu in connivance with other member of his ritualistic gang namely Aremu Moshood (48), Agboola Abdulwasiu (31) and Ganiyu Abidoye (60), lured little Bakare from his parent's home under the pretext that they wanted to buy him groundnut and then proceeded to kill him and behead him in Iragbiji, the headquarters of Boripe Local Government Area of Osun State.


Police sources say the matter came to the open after Bakare did not return with Ganiyu who promised to buy him groundnut. When Bakare's father, Ismail, sought to know his son's where about, Ganiyu denied that he ever saw the little boy. His claim was however contradicted by an elderly woman who lived in the same compound with Bakare's father who said she saw Ganiyu take the young boy out.

The matter was reported to the office of the FSARS and through intensive interrogation, Ganiyu confessed to have taken the boy to an unknown destination with the sole aim of using him for money ritual. He said that himself and his gang members had cut off Bakare's head and buried it in a shallow grave and then threw his body within the same vicinity and buried it with leaves 
Ganiyu while confessing said.

“I am a palm fruit cutter. The mother of the body came to my house to tell me that she would need my services to cut palm fruits, asking me to come the following day. But I went to her house at about 5.30p.m same day. I took the young boy with me, with the belief that no one noticed when he was going with me. I bought N20 worth of groundnut for him before taking him to my house at Iyana Olofa.”

Ganiyu initially claimed that he got Bakare at the prompting of his partner, Moshood, who had earlier asked him to bring the urine, blood and hair of a young boy when he went to Moshood for money ritual and for protection. The suspect added that he went to Abdulwasiu for the same ritual and he also asked him to bring a boy. Ganiyu also indicted his father, Abidoye, in his statement, saying that he was the one also told him to kill a boy and bury his body so that his acts would not be exposed.

He told the police that he took the deceased to Olokede bush where he cut his head with a knife and buried it, while he threw the body away. Investigations showed that Ganiyu had once been arrested in 2012 for stealing a child at Otapete area of Iragbiji. He was said to have been beaten and macheted by indigenes of the town before he was taken to the police station, while the rescued boy was returned to his parents. Ganiyu was eventually charged to court and spent seven months in Ilesa prison.

Ganiyu and his other accomplices have been dragged before an Osogbo magistrates’ court on a four-count charge of conspiracy, kidnapping, murder and unlawful and intentional killing of Teslim Bakare. The suspects, whose pleas were not taken by Magistrate B.B Idowu Ajao, ordered that the suspects be remanded in prison till February 18th for the next hearing on the case.

Appeal Court sacks Abia Governor, Okezie Ikpeazu, declares APGA’s Alex Otti winner

The Court of Appeal, sitting in Owerri, has removed Okezie Ikpeazu of the Peoples Democratic Party as governor of Abia State. The court also...
The Court of Appeal, sitting in Owerri, has removed Okezie Ikpeazu of the Peoples Democratic Party as governor of Abia State.

The court also declared Alex Otti of the All Progressives Grand Alliance  the winner of the April 11 and April 25 supplementary elections in the state.

Delivering judgment in an appeal filed by Mr. Otti, the five-member panel, headed by Justice Oyebisi Omoleye, said the APGA candidate scored 164, 444 valid votes to defeat Mr. Ikpeazu who scored 114, 444 votes.

The court declared that Mr. Otti was the winner of the April 11 and April 25 supplementary elections in Abia.

Justice Omoleye said the cancellation of the elections held in three LGAs of Obingwa, Osisioma Ngwa and Isiala Ngwa by the returning officers after the results were uploaded to INEC was wrong.
“In the Electoral Act, the Returning Officer has the right to only declare results of elections and not to cancel elections.

“This panel discovered that the earlier results uploaded to INEC headquarters correspond with the correct valid registered voters in the three LGAs, while that awarded to the respondent shows over voting and therefore null and void.’’

Justice Omoleye had while reviewing preliminary objections and issues raised by both parties, struck out the preliminary objections by Mr. Ikpeazu’s counsel to the effect that the appeal lacked merit.
The court also turned down the objection raised by the PDP that the members of the panel were wrongfully constituted and affirmed the arguments of Mr. Otti’s counsel.

The appellate court maintained that the lower tribunal erred by not handling all the issues raised before it on their merit.

“It was wrong for the court below to insist that because the appellant failed to appear in person, his matter will not be given due attention.

“For not appearing in person, the first appellant did not abandon his case,” she said.
The court insisted that there was no need to call for re-run because the results of the April 11 and 25 polls clearly present Mr. Otti as the genuine winner of the exercise.

The court therefore directed INEC to issue Certificate of Return to Mr. Otti and swear him in as winner of the Abia Governorship election.

In his reaction to the judgment, Oracle Nwali, a lawyer in Mr. Otti’s legal team, described the victory as “an end of the year gift to APGA”, saying Mr. Otti would not disappoint Abia people.
On his part, Charles Esonu, the PDP secretary in Abia, said the party and its candidate would study the judgment and decide on the next line of action.

Mr. Otti had proceeded to the Court of Appeal after the Abia tribunal gave its judgment on November 3, saying the PDP validly won the election.

In that 85-minute judgment, delivered by its Chairman, Usman Bwala, the tribunal said  the petitioners – Mr. Otti and APGA – failed to prove their claim to have won the election ‘’beyond doubt”.

Mr. Bwala said the petitioners had, on one hand urged the court to nullify the election on grounds that it was marred by irregularities and massive fraud and on the other hand, sought that they should be declared winners of the same election.

He said the petitioners reckoned with the card reader as a means of accreditation during the election of April 11 but failed to agree with use of voter’s register.

The tribunal further refused to grant the petitioners’ request to uphold the cancellation of the results of the election in Obingwa, Osisioma and Isiala-Ngwa North Local Government Areas of the state.

Mr. Bwala said the State Returning Officer, Benjamin Ozumba, was not allowed under the law, to cancel the said results in the first place, hence the subsequent reversal by him had no effect.
He said the onus lay heavily on the petitioners to prove beyond doubt that they won the election as they claimed in their petition.

The tribunal chairman, therefore, dismissed the petition because of the failure of the petitioners to convince the tribunal beyond doubt that they won the election.

Mr. Otti had urged the tribunal to annul the declaration of Mr. Ikpeazu as governor, saying the election was marred by irregularities and substantial non-compliance with the Electoral Act.
He, however, urged the tribunal to declare him (Otti) the winner on account of the lawful votes cast during the election.

He also asked the tribunal to uphold Mr. Ozumba’s cancellation of the results for Obingwa, Osisioma and Isiala-Ngwa North LGAs.
He said that Ozumba, having cancelled the results, did not have the power to cancel the result and reverse himself, adding that only the tribunal had the power to reverse the cancellation.

Appeal Court Upturns Mama Taraba’s (APC) Victory And Declares Ishaku (PDP) Winner

A court of appeal sitting in Abuja on Thursday, December 31, upturned the decision of the Taraba state election tribunal which declared the ...
A court of appeal sitting in Abuja on Thursday, December 31, upturned the decision of the Taraba state election tribunal which declared the All Progressives Congress (APC)’s Aisha Alhassan the winner of the Taraba governorship election.

The court decided in favor of the cand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P)’s candidate, Governor Darius Dickson Ishaku, ruling that Ishaku’s nomination by the PDP could not be questioned by a non-member of the party.

The Justice Danladi Abubakar-led tribunal had on November 7 sacked the Peoples Democratic Party’s Ishaku and declared All Progressives Congress’ Aisha Alhassan the winner.

But Governor Darius Ishaku, who expressed confidence in holding on to his position, following the possibility of going to the poll for a third time, filed an appeal asking the court to set it the judgement of the state tribunal aside.

Ahead of today’s judgment, on December 21, the Justice Abdul Aboki-led five-man bench of the appeal court heard three appeals and a cross-appeal by the APC.

Dasuki Rearrested After Being Granted Bail Yesterday

Former National Security Adviser (NSA), Sambo Dasuki, who was recently released on bail by the Department of State Services (DSS) has been r...
Former National Security Adviser (NSA), Sambo Dasuki, who was recently released on bail by the Department of State Services (DSS) has been rearrested.

As seen on Naij.com and composed by Daily Trust, Dasuki’s rearrest took place shortly after being released from the Kuje Prison in Abuja.

The former NSA, who is standing trial in three different courts in Abuja for alleged money laundering offences running into billions of Naira, was taken to court by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) but regained his freedom temporarily after being granted bail last week along with former Sokoto state governor, Attahiru Bafarawa and his son, Sagir, as well as a former NNPC top official, Aminu Baba Kusa.

But, in a rather stunning twist of fate, Dasuki’s lawyer, Ahmed Raji (SAN) confirmed his re-arrest to Daily Trust last night.

This report was also corroborated by Chief Olufemi Fani-Kayode in a tweet on Tuesday, December 29, 2015.

75% of Fuel in Nigeria Will Still Be Imported in 2016 - NNPC

Group Managing Director NNPC and Minister of State for Petroleum , Dr. Ibe Kachikwu , during his tour of Kaduna Refinery and Petrochemica...
Group Managing Director NNPC and Minister of State for Petroleum, Dr. Ibe Kachikwu, during his tour of Kaduna Refinery and Petrochemical Company, KRPC, yesterday, said the country will still rely on 75 per cent importation of fuel throughout the whole of next year.


According to him:
“The future is that, Nigeria is still going to import fuel in 2016 and beyond. Best case situation is 25 per cent local and 75 per cent importation. Worse case is what we are experiencing now.
“Until we begin to get individuals who can co-relocate, we are going to be doing a mixture of local and importation of fuel to meet up demands. In the next few weeks, however, queues will disappear in fuel stations.”The minister said that the Kaduna refinery will soon be producing more than two million litres per day capacity as soon as an Fluid Catalytic Cracking, FCC, unit is fully on stream.
He said:
“We need to get it back to re-kit it to work well. We will do that with some level of production going on. Our concern is to have a consistent production and provision of products at all times.”
“We will not be fluctuating prices, we will take an average. Today no subsidy, in January we will look at the situation and announce it.”
In regards to privatization, he said:
President Muhammadu Buhari has not approved any policy about selling the refineries.” - says Vanguard

Female Suicide Bomber kill family of 15 in Maiduguri

A female suicide bomber attacked the home of a village head, Bulama Isa in Maiduguri  yesterday evening, killing his three wives and thei...
A female suicide bomber attacked the home of a village head, Bulama Isa in Maiduguri yesterday evening, killing his three wives and their 10 children yesterday December 27th. The incident happened as Boko haram members engaged the Nigerian troops in a gun battle earlier yesterday evening.
Eyewitnesses say the woman pretended Boko Haram was chasing her, as she ran into the compound of the village head.

According to Eyewitness
“She ran into Bulama Isa’s compound shouting ‘Boko Haram, Boko Haram. When the families of Isa all came out of their rooms to meet the woman in the center of their compound, the woman simply detonated the bomb she had under her garment killing the man his three wives and ten children” a witness said
Bulama Isa who had not returned home yet at the time his home came under attack managed to survive another suicide attack at the entrance of his home. Sources said another female suicide who was lurking in the dark as the grief struck head of the family walked into his attacked compound, jumped out and detonated herself: but the village head was lucky again.
 
He was able to escape with minor injury, but the blast had succeeded in killing a woman with her baby.
